Bouncy Castle Cryptography Library 1.37

org.bouncycastle.jce.provider.test
Class IESTest

java.lang.Object
  extended by org.bouncycastle.util.test.SimpleTest
      extended by org.bouncycastle.jce.provider.test.IESTest
All Implemented Interfaces:
Test

public class IESTest
extends SimpleTest

test for ECIES - Elliptic Curve Integrated Encryption Scheme


Method Summary
 void doDefTest(java.security.KeyPairGenerator g, javax.crypto.Cipher c1, javax.crypto.Cipher c2)
           
 void doTest(java.security.KeyPairGenerator g, javax.crypto.Cipher c1, javax.crypto.Cipher c2)
           
 java.lang.String getName()
           
static void main(java.lang.String[] args)
           
 void performTest()
           
 
Methods inherited from class org.bouncycastle.util.test.SimpleTest
areEqual, fail, fail, fail, perform, runTest, runTest
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Method Detail

getName

public java.lang.String getName()
Specified by:
getName in interface Test
Specified by:
getName in class SimpleTest

performTest

public void performTest()
                 throws java.lang.Exception
Specified by:
performTest in class SimpleTest
Throws:
java.lang.Exception

doTest

public void doTest(java.security.KeyPairGenerator g,
                   javax.crypto.Cipher c1,
                   javax.crypto.Cipher c2)
            throws java.lang.Exception
Throws:
java.lang.Exception

doDefTest

public void doDefTest(java.security.KeyPairGenerator g,
                      javax.crypto.Cipher c1,
                      javax.crypto.Cipher c2)
               throws java.lang.Exception
Throws:
java.lang.Exception

main

public static void main(java.lang.String[] args)

Bouncy Castle Cryptography Library 1.37